Diffusion is when somebody avoids or refuses both of those exploration and creating a dedication. Foreclosure occurs when an individual does produce a dedication to a this website specific identity but neglected to check out other available choices. Identity moratorium is when someone avoids or postpones building a motivation but continues to be actively exploring their choices and distinct identities. Finally, identity accomplishment is when somebody has both equally explored quite a few opportunities and has dedicated to their identity.[25]
